1. N-COUNT (建筑物)立面,立面图,立视图 In architecture, an elevation is the front, back, or side of a building, or a drawing of one of these. 
  • ...the addition of two-storey wings on the north and south elevations.

    在南北向的立视图上各增加两层配楼

2. N-COUNT 海拔 The elevation of a place is its height above sea level. 
  • We're probably at an elevation of about 13,000 feet above sea level.

    我们可能在大约海拔13,000英尺的高度。

3. N-COUNT 高地;高处 An elevation is a piece of ground that is higher than the area around it.

Noun

1. the event of something being raised upward;

  • "an elevation of the temperature in the afternoon"
  • "a raising of the land resulting from volcanic activity"

2. the highest level or degree attainable;

  • "his landscapes were deemed the acme of beauty"
  • "the artist's gifts are at their acme"
  • "at the height of her career"
  • "the peak of perfection"
  • "summer was at its peak"
  • "...catapulted Einstein to the pinnacle of fame"
  • "the summit of his ambition"
  • "so many highest superlatives achieved by man"
  • "at the top of his profession"

3. angular distance above the horizon (especially of a celestial object)

4. a raised or elevated geological formation

5. distance of something above a reference point (such as sea level);

  • "there was snow at the higher elevations"

6. (ballet) the height of a dancer's leap or jump;

  • "a dancer of exceptional elevation"

7. drawing of an exterior of a structure

8. the act of increasing the wealth or prestige or power or scope of something;

  • "the aggrandizement of the king"
  • "his elevation to cardinal"
